@vuejs_ru

Страница 3124 из 3900
Roman
21.06.2018
13:16:32
Как?)
ну постменом дерни на тот сервис

? гриб
21.06.2018
13:17:09
<input v-model="message"> // ... computed: { message: { get () { return this.$store.state.obj.message }, set (value) { this.$store.commit('updateMessage', value) } } }
а если мне на get нужно ещё метод какой-нибудь выполнить? не считается ли зашкваром в этот геттер запихнуть ещё и вызов функции?

Google
? гриб
21.06.2018
13:17:14
синхронной

или же лучше вотчер наверн

? гриб
21.06.2018
13:20:09
В 99% случаев считается :)
а навесить вотчер на computed не зашквар? самое оно? )

наверно да. довольно логично выглядит )

Hedint
21.06.2018
13:23:00
а навесить вотчер на computed не зашквар? самое оно? )
хз, все зависит от того, какую проблему пытаться решить. но так делают иногда, да

? гриб
21.06.2018
13:24:03
хз, все зависит от того, какую проблему пытаться решить. но так делают иногда, да
получая данные из стора, я должен скормить их плагину )

но при этом ещё и иметь эти данные в v-model

меняя radiobutton данные сохраняются в стор, плагин кушает новые входящие )

а стор в свою очередь сохраяет их на сервак

ну и изначально получает оттуда

Google
Pavel
21.06.2018
13:29:53
Сделать watch на пропс и менять через this.mode = value?
А мне ж не надо watch, мне надо 1 раз

Dmitry
21.06.2018
13:30:47
А мне ж не надо watch, мне надо 1 раз
Ну сделай во время created this.mode = this.initialMode

Pavel
21.06.2018
13:31:12
Сергей
21.06.2018
13:32:00
подскажите, у меня кнопка на андроиде и на любом пк работает. но на айфоне нет, в чем может быть проблема?

Pavel
21.06.2018
13:32:30
@dmitry_sv Данке шон!

Denis
21.06.2018
13:36:38
На айфоне есть проблема с click – лучше юзать touch
в стилях проставлен cursor:pointer? на ios без него не будут клики работать

Pavel
21.06.2018
13:36:53
Всё равно не работает

В this.initialMode всё равно не то, что спускает родитель

А дефолт

Dmitry
21.06.2018
13:37:30
Всё равно не работает
Тогда лучше сделай на watch Возможно ты передаешь не статические данные, а полученные с сервера

Pavel
21.06.2018
13:37:32
Даже внутри created

Я передаю строку из объекта

Pavel
21.06.2018
13:38:07
<Employment :initialMode="employment.mode" />

Dmitry
21.06.2018
13:38:22
Я передаю строку из объекта
Ну а employment ты откуда берешь?

Pavel
21.06.2018
13:38:34
Элемент массива

Dmitry
21.06.2018
13:38:45
А массив откуда приходит?

Pavel
21.06.2018
13:39:07
В data лежит

Google
Dmitry
21.06.2018
13:39:34
Ты его туда руками положил, или это пришедшие с сервера данные?

Также, твой массив может долго обрабатываться, и в результате твой дочерний элемент успеет отренериться раньше, чем отработается массив

Pavel
21.06.2018
13:40:08
Пока что руками. И кнопка создаёт новые элементы массива. И вот с новыми элементами такая жопа

Dmitry
21.06.2018
13:41:25
Хз как объяснить Просто попробуй watch :) Это вполне хорошее и правильное решение



Michael
21.06.2018
13:42:32
ээээ блин

почоны

какой вотч7

зачем кому-то тут вотч?

Dmitry
21.06.2018
13:42:59
Смотреть за изменением пропса

Pavel
21.06.2018
13:43:20
Господа, я дебил

Проблема была вообще не в этом

Сергей
21.06.2018
13:43:37
в стилях проставлен cursor:pointer? на ios без него не будут клики работать
а это стандартный дег vue и будет он работать как click на компах

Michael
21.06.2018
13:44:47
Смотреть за изменением пропса
он и так смотрибелен, блин

Pavel
21.06.2018
13:44:48
У меня key был одинаковый для всех членов массива. И рендер при добавлении нового элемента в начало массива считал что mode не именился, потому что ключ элемента тот же, то и был.

Michael
21.06.2018
13:45:06
зачем вам смотреть за изменением пропса? какая цель итоговая?

ну кроме как сделать хорошо

Pavel
21.06.2018
13:45:13
Спасибо большое за помощь!

Dmitry
21.06.2018
13:45:24
Pavel
21.06.2018
13:47:48
В общем, писать :key="index" — плохая идея, если массив мутабельный

Google
Michael
21.06.2018
13:48:10
А мне ж не надо watch, мне надо 1 раз
скинь в чём проблема ыла, плз

Pavel
21.06.2018
13:48:21
Уже решена

watch и created ни при чём

Michael
21.06.2018
13:49:04
? чаще всего, watch не нужен.

Fil
21.06.2018
13:50:25


чего то

Vladislav
21.06.2018
13:51:41
это bootstrap studio вроде

Admin
ERROR: S client not available

Hedint
21.06.2018
13:51:43
ну там же в заголовке написано что это

Michael
21.06.2018
13:52:00
лол

Fil
21.06.2018
13:52:17
а ну да

а что есть из подобного

Michael
21.06.2018
13:52:46
Adobe редаткор

brackets

Fil
21.06.2018
13:53:01
в интернете перекати поле на эту тему

Michael
21.06.2018
13:53:12
только эта. ты уверен, что не хочешь просто vue HMR?

и два экрана

Vladislav
21.06.2018
13:53:48
а причем тут hmr

Fil
21.06.2018
13:53:51
brackets
ну эт чистый код

Vladislav
21.06.2018
13:54:10
мне кажется он имел ввиду что-то по типу авакода/зеплина

Google
Michael
21.06.2018
13:54:11
у него главная фича - встроенный пантовый предосмотр

Fil
21.06.2018
13:54:21
то что там есть хот релоа

Pavel
21.06.2018
13:54:24
Stanislav
21.06.2018
13:54:25
ну эт чистый код
Это чат по Vue.js. Причем тут твой редактор?

Fil
21.06.2018
13:54:43
я прост видел по реакту такое

Fil
21.06.2018
13:54:54
мож вьюшники замутили себе

Michael
21.06.2018
13:54:54
Кстати, с аналогами цеплина вали в дизайнерский чат. Мы тут бездушные кодерыю

Zae
21.06.2018
13:54:57
плз в спеицальный чатик

Michael
21.06.2018
13:55:07
мож вьюшники замутили себе
вьюшникам не нужны костыли :D

у нас и HMR и кссы хорошо работают

Vladislav
21.06.2018
13:55:25
(нет)

Stanislav
21.06.2018
13:56:01
мож вьюшники замутили себе
Ну тогда так и надо спрашивать :) Лично я такого не видел

Fil
21.06.2018
13:56:23
что за HRM

Zae
21.06.2018
13:56:35
hot module replacement

Michael
21.06.2018
13:57:08
что за HRM
heart rate monitor, youpta

Hedint
21.06.2018
13:57:12
holy map reduce

Michael
21.06.2018
13:57:37
(нет)
это надо постараться чтобы нет.

Sunlive
21.06.2018
14:02:02
heart rate monitor, youpta
нихуя фотка на аве

где ты нашел ее?

Страница 3124 из 3900